There are large red butt plug shaped devices throughout the final stage that spew out red mines. They can be quite the pain in the ass. The PS version has this enemy removed completely allowing the player to glide past the final stage more smoothly.Restart_Point wrote:And to end on a couple of non gameplay-related points, the Saturn (and arcade) version has the destructible iceberg sprites floating in the water around the middle of stage one, but they are totally absent in the PS1 version, which is odd and makes me wonder if the PS1 version is missing any other assets I haven't noticed.
